클로드 코드 사용법: 설치 후 실제로 쓰는 법 (명령·VS Code)

Claude Code를 설치한 뒤 실제 사용법을 정리했습니다. claude 실행, @파일 참조, diff 승인, 핵심 명령·단축키, 대화형/원샷 모드, VS Code 확장까지.

Claude Code를 설치했다면, 이제 쓰는 법입니다. 핵심은 간단합니다 — 프로젝트 폴더에서 claude를 실행하고, 대화로 작업을 지시하면 클로드가 파일을 직접 읽고 고칩니다. 단, 파일을 바꾸기 전에는 항상 변경 내용(diff)을 보여주고 승인을 받습니다.

클로드 코드 기본 흐름 1. 실행 폴더에서 claude 2. 작업 지시 @파일로 요청 3. diff 검토 승인 / 거부 4. 반복·롤백 /rewind 파일 변경 전 항상 diff로 보여주고 승인을 받습니다. 잘못되면 /rewind로 되돌립니다.

시작하기

  1. 작업할 프로젝트 폴더에서 터미널을 열고 claude를 실행합니다. 첫 실행 시 브라우저 로그인(OAuth)을 한 번 합니다.
  2. 환영 화면 뒤에 대화형 프롬프트가 뜹니다. 여기에 자연어로 작업을 지시하면 됩니다.
# 프로젝트 폴더로 이동 후
claude

실행한 폴더와 그 하위 파일을 클로드가 볼 수 있으니, 어느 폴더에서 실행하는지를 신경 쓰세요.

작업 지시 + 파일 참조

그냥 자연어로 요청하면 됩니다. 특정 파일을 콕 집으려면 @ 뒤에 경로를 입력합니다(자동완성 지원). 그 파일 내용이 대화에 바로 주입됩니다.

@src/pages/Home.tsx 헤더 문구를 'Welcome'으로 바꿔줘

클로드는 바꿀 내용을 diff(변경 미리보기)로 보여주고 승인을 요청합니다. 승인·거부·수정 요청을 고를 수 있습니다.

알아두면 좋은 명령·단축키

  • / — 사용 가능한 슬래시 명령 목록
  • @경로 — 특정 파일을 컨텍스트에 추가
  • ! — 터미널 명령을 실행하고 그 결과를 클로드에 전달
  • ? — 단축키 보기 / Tab 자동완성 / 이전 입력
  • Esc — 진행 중인 작업 중단
  • /rewind 또는 Esc 두 번 — 이전 체크포인트로 되돌리기(매 편집마다 스냅샷 저장)
  • /login 계정 전환 · /mcp MCP 서버 관리

두 가지 사용 모드

  • 대화형(기본): claude로 세션을 열고 여러 번 주고받으며 작업. 복잡한 구현에 적합.
  • 원샷: claude -p "src/api 폴더에서 TODO가 남은 곳 전부 찾아줘"처럼 한 번 실행하고 결과만 받기. 스크립트·CI·단순 조회에 적합.

VS Code에서 쓰기

두 가지 방법이 있습니다.

  • 공식 확장("Claude Code for VS Code"): 에디터 사이드바에 패널이 생기고, 변경을 diff 뷰로 보며 클릭으로 승인합니다. (Cursor에서도 VS Code 확장이라 작동)
  • 내장 터미널에서 claude를 직접 실행: 파일 변경이 에디터 탭에 바로 반영됩니다. MCP 설정, ! 명령, 일부 슬래시 명령은 CLI(터미널)에서만 됩니다.

안전장치

Claude Code는 기본적으로 파일 쓰기·명령 실행 전에 승인을 요구합니다(Ask 모드). 위험한 명령(강제 푸시·삭제 등)을 막도록 권한을 설정할 수도 있습니다. 그리고 매 편집이 체크포인트로 저장되어 /rewind로 되돌릴 수 있습니다.

더 잘 쓰는 법

프로젝트의 구조·규칙·자주 쓰는 명령을 CLAUDE.md에 적어두면 매 세션이 빨라지고 실수가 줄어듭니다. 작성법은 CLAUDE.md 작성 가이드를 참고하세요. 외부 도구 연동은 MCP 연결 가이드.

고지: Claude Code는 Claude Pro·Max·Team·Enterprise 구독에 포함되거나 API 종량제로 쓸 수 있습니다(포함 범위·요금은 변동). 명령·단축키·확장 동작은 버전에 따라 바뀔 수 있으니 공식 문서(code.claude.com/docs)에서 최신 정보를 확인하세요. 본 사이트는 Anthropic 공식 사이트가 아닙니다.

이어서 읽어보세요

궁금한 점이 있거나 활용법을 나누고 싶나요?

커뮤니티에서 다른 사용자들과 팁과 노하우를 나눠보세요. 더 많은 가이드도 준비되어 있어요.